Seeley International is Australia’s largest manufacturer of climate control and HVAC solutions for domestic, commercial, and industrial markets, with iconic brands such as Breezair, Braemar, Coolair, Climate Wizard and Convair. For more than fifty years, this Australian owned family business has led the industry with groundbreaking innovations.
Seeley International currently employs more than 500 staff and has significant growth plans, both in Australia and overseas, which will further cement its reputation as a leader in its field.
